Transaction eced2856fd1270d476a8ced3e6805e2a5c02ceb40ec0380ce0cb5b8f695b36b5

3 Input
2 Outputs
  • eced2856fd1270d476a8ced3e6805e2a5c02ceb40ec0380ce0cb5b8f695b36b5:0
  • value  1009248
    address  1C25NFD2BHSZn65AeJKNdMFFSrfPw9kexR
  • eced2856fd1270d476a8ced3e6805e2a5c02ceb40ec0380ce0cb5b8f695b36b5:1
  • value  5178290
    address  172WiXDTKSr2f6X4MLZrJPLiJ563pPpkoQ